PAY RATE: $8.00 per hour

SUPERVISOR: Assistant Director of Operations and Graduate Assistant of Operations

JOB FUNCTION: Assist with the day-to-day operations of the 150,000 sq. ft. Campus Rec Center (CRC) which includes enforcing policies and procedures, helping with first aid and emergencies, and daily facility upkeep/cleaning.

HOURS: Up to 25 hours per week. Flexible work schedules (morning, afternoon, evening, night, and weekend shifts)

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Main point of contact and responsible for assisting up to 300 patron visits per shift.
  • Ensure facility user safety by having a strong knowledge of the building's policies and procedures and being up to date on CRC evacuation and risk management strategies.
  • Provide exceptional customer service to patrons by having strong communication and interacting with everyone in a respectful, cooperative manner.
  • Maintain a professional appearance and attitude throughout shifts.
  • Serve as a campus resource by providing accurate and current information regarding recreation and university-related programs and facilities.
  • Assist Facility Supervisors with facility operations that include equipment set up and tear down, cleaning, evacuation, and hourly usage reports.
  • Report to authority figures such as lead staff, supervisors, managers, and professional staff.
  • Assist with other duties as assigned (may result in helping other departments within Campus Rec).
  • This is a cleaning heavy position

POSITION REQUIREMENTS:

  • Currently enrolled in 6 or more credit hours at Sam Houston State University
  • Successfully pass the State of Texas criminal background check
  • Must obtain a valid CPR/AED and First Aid certification within the first 30 days of employment
  • Completion of SHSU student employee compliance training and any additional trainings required by the department and university
  • Must work early mornings or late nights

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Able to work on weekends, early mornings, and late nights throughout the week
  • Possess a passion for working with people and around fitness and wellness
  • Be able to work in an active, crowded, and fast-paced environment
  • Must have an increased focus on being punctual, reliable, and dependable
  • Excellent communication skills and the able to work with a wide variety of personalities
  • Open to constructive feedback while also keeping a positive and upbeat attitude
  • Ability to handle conflict as well as confront patrons in a calm and professional manner
